Book
Cognitive Work Analysis: Toward Safe, Productive, and Healthy Computer-Based Work
by Kim Vicente
📖 Overview
Cognitive Work Analysis presents a systematic framework for analyzing, designing, and evaluating human-computer systems to improve safety and effectiveness. The book outlines methods for understanding how workers interact with complex technological environments, with a focus on creating systems that support human capabilities and limitations.
Vicente draws on real-world examples from aviation, healthcare, nuclear power, and other high-stakes domains to demonstrate the practical application of cognitive work analysis principles. The text provides detailed guidance on conducting work domain analysis, control task analysis, strategies analysis, social organization analysis, and worker competencies analysis.
The methodology described bridges the gap between purely theoretical approaches and narrowly focused practical solutions in human-computer interaction. Through this comprehensive treatment of cognitive work analysis, Vicente establishes a foundation for developing technology that better serves both worker needs and organizational goals while maintaining safety.
The book stands as a significant contribution to the field of human factors engineering, advocating for a systems-based approach that considers the full context of work environments rather than isolated technical components. Its core message about supporting human adaptation and flexibility within complex systems remains relevant to modern workplace challenges.

🤔 Interesting facts
🔍 Kim Vicente was both a mechanical engineer and a cognitive psychologist, bringing a unique dual perspective to his work on human-computer interaction.
💡 The book introduces the "ecological approach" to interface design, which emphasizes analyzing the work environment before designing solutions - a revolutionary concept when published in 1999.
🏆 Vicente's research has influenced safety protocols in high-risk industries like nuclear power plants, aviation, and medical devices.
🌍 The methodology described in the book has been adopted by organizations worldwide, including NASA, the US Military, and various healthcare systems.
📚 The book builds on earlier work by Jens Rasmussen at Risø National Laboratory in Denmark, where the foundations of Cognitive Work Analysis were first developed in the 1960s.
